Vin Diesel’s journey in Hollywood began at age seven on a New York stage, leading him to explore storytelling through writing and filmmaking. After his early directorial efforts in films like Multi-Facial and Strays, he gained prominence with Saving Private Ryan, where Steven Spielberg recognized his potential as a filmmaker. Despite Diesel’s success in acting and producing, Spielberg expressed disappointment over his lack of directing since Strays, urging him to return to the director’s chair. Diesel still harbors aspirations to create historical war films but has yet to materialize these projects.
